What happens in Spiritual Direction

Spiritual direction is a simple, ongoing conversation where you slow down and attend to your inner life in the presence of another person trained to listen with care and attention.

In a typical session:

  • You begin wherever you are—no preparation required

  • You may speak, pause, or reflect quietly

  • We listen together for what feels meaningful, confusing, or alive

  • There is no pressure to “perform” or have answers

What it is not:

  • Not therapy or counseling

  • Not advice-giving or problem-solving

  • Not evaluation or correction

First session note:
Your first session is exploratory—we simply meet, talk, and see whether this space feels supportive for you.
